Remplir textbox par une partie d'un choix d'une listbox

  • Initiateur de la discussion Initiateur de la discussion Blafi
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

Blafi

XLDnaute Occasionnel
Bonjour le forum et bonne soirée,

J'ai un petit pb que je vous soumets :

Dans un USF, j'ai une combobox1 (ou listbox même pb) qui m'affiche la liste des nom_prénom d'adhérents qui se trouvent dans une base de donnée.
Sous cette combobox (ou listbox) j'ai une combobox2 (modifiable) et je voudrais que par défaut lorsqu'un nom-prénom est choisi dans la combobox1, cette combobox2 affiche le nom de la personne choisie (sans le prénom)..

Sous excel je sais faire en utilisant CHERCHE() et en cherchant ou est l'espace pour prendre ce qui est à sa gauche mais dans un code vba (le code de la combobox1) je ne sais pas quoi utiliser...

Merci à celui qui pourrait me donner le code me permettant de récupérer ce qui se trouve avant l'espace du choix de combobox1..

A ++
 
Re : Remplir textbox par une partie d'un choix d'une listbox

Bonsoir Blafi,

Il te faut appliquer l'instruction 'Instr', par exemple :

Left(TonTexte,InStr(TonTexte," ") - 1)

Celà a pour effet de calculer la position du 1er espace, et d'extraire la partie gauche de la chaîne jusqu'à ce 1er espace.

Espérant t'avoir aidé.

Cordialement.
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Retour